10 Skin- Saving Foods


Avocados
Avocados are rich in polyhydroxylated fatty alcohols (PFAs), which protect the skin from UV damage and inflammation and repair DNA, plus the monounsaturated fats they contain enhance the availability of sun-protective nutrients from other fruits and vegetables. Eat this: Add avocados to smoothies; purée avocados with lemon juice and olive oil for a healthy salad dressing; combine avocado chunks with corn kernels, diced peppers, onions and lime juice for an easy salsa.
